Trusting God

This morning's reading in Tabletalk magazine tells a story of a young girl who is disappointed in her parents' plans for her good. Indeed, her parents' plans are better for her than she in her immaturity can see. The reading tells of Abraham's thought that God was granting His promise of a great nation through his already existing son Ishmael (Genesis 17). "The principles of how we are to act in certain situations are clearly given in Scripture. Yet, like Abraham, we can be guilty of going our own way. When the Lord plainly mkaes His intent for us known, we must dutifully obey Him, even if it is not something we want to do."
